Transaction cbb39e26a23d63de9161e4118f72cf28a4a7911fcce715c7423faf2ef68823c7
1 Input
1 Output
-
cbb39e26a23d63de9161e4118f72cf28a4a7911fcce715c7423faf2ef68823c7:0
- value
- 45533
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d896033c44d42926fd9a54c9923062370cba1d28 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LkCfVnGGYFciXUNDsQqnyj75avG6Jw89o